Go Fish Ministries Mission Statement

The vision and mission of Go Fish Ministries, Inc. is to help victims of sexual and domestic violence through their healing process and to encourage and help others in need, whether physically, emotionally, or spiritually within the context of a Christian environment. Go Fish Ministries, Inc. Articles of Faith

Go Fish Ministries Articles of Faith
1. We believe that there is one true God, Yahweh, who is the Creator of all things, and the only appropriate entity of religious worship.

2. We believe that there is a tri-fold Consciousness in the Godhead – Yahweh God, Yeshua, the Christ, and the Holy Spirit - indivisible in essence and equal in power and glory.

3. We believe that in the person of Yeshua, the Christ, who was born of the virgin, Mary, the Divine and human natures are unified, so that the Christ is wholly God, while also fully complete in humanity, androgynous in nature.

4. We believe that humankind was created in the image of the Godhead with a tri-fold consciousness (Heart- spiritual essence and God consciousness, Soul-natural emotions, and Mind-acquired knowledge, as well as a physical body-Strength) based on Mark 12:30, and that God breathed the breath of life into the first human being, who became a living soul.

5. We believe that humanity was created in a state of innocence, but by our ancestral disobedience we lost our purity of spirit; and that in consequence of the fall, all human beings have become sinners, and as such are rightly deserving of the judgment of God.

6. We believe that Yeshua, the Christ has, by suffering and death on the cross of Calvary, paid the price for the sins of humanity, so that whoever believes in the Christ, by confession of that faith may be saved.

7. We believe that turning back to God (repentance) to be set apart (sanctification), faith in the forgiveness of sinners (justification) by our Savior Yeshua, the Christ, and the becoming a new person (regeneration) by the work of Holy Spirit are necessary to the process of salvation.

8. We believe that we are justified by grace, through faith in our Sovereign Yeshua, the Christ; and that all who believe have the witness of the Holy Spirit within their own spirit, which Spirit also imparts to believers various spiritual gifts, and that while all believers receive at least one spiritual gift, not all Christians receive the same gift.

9. We believe that the state of salvation depends upon the grace of God and is eternally given at the moment of justification (true repentance, turning from habitual sinful behaviors) in Christ, though sanctification (God’s blessings) and regeneration (new and abundant life through the Holy Spirit) is contingent on continued obedience and faith in Christ.

10. We believe that it is the privilege and duty of all believers to become wholly sanctified, and that their whole spirit, soul, mind, and body may be preserved blameless unto the coming of our Savior Yeshua, the Christ.

11. We believe in the immortality of the soul; in the resurrection of the body; in the judgment of souls at the end of the world as we know it; in the eternal joy of the righteous; and in the separation of the evil ones from God and their eternal punishment in Hell.

12. We believe that the precepts of the Old and New Testaments were given by inspiration of God; and that they are the Divine rule of Christian faith and principles.

13. We believe that the ordinances of Baptism and the Communion of the Last Supper set forth by Christ in the Holy Scripture, though not necessary for salvation, should be kept whenever and however possible in obedience to the command of Christ and in remembrance of the death and resurrection of Christ.

14. We believe in the Holy Spirit’s dispensation of Prophecy and Preaching to Women in these last days, spoken of by the prophet Joel in 2:28-29, and attested to by Peter in Acts 2:14-21.

15.We believe in the signs of miracles, that is the supernatural control of natural forces by God.

16. We believe in the great commission of Yeshua, the Christ, that we are to go into every part of the whole world and baptize others in the name of Yahweh God, Yeshua, the Christ, and the Holy Spirit.

17. We believe that Christians should let no one judge them in meat, drink, or in respect of days of worship and holydays (Colossians 2: 16), though we should not let our customs be a snare to others, refraining from the appearance of evil whenever possible.

We will make a conscious effort to be responsive to the Holy Spirit's work and obedient to the Spirit’s leading, growing in God’s grace through worship, prayer, service and the reading of the Bible. We will make the Realm of God first priority, setting aside the goals of this world.



We will seek to uphold Christian integrity in every area of life, allowing no thought, word or deed that is profane, dishonest, or immoral to take root in the heart.



We will maintain Christian ideals in all relationships with others; family, neighbors, and co-workers in Christ, those we are responsible to and for, and the community at large worldwide.



We will uphold the sanctity of heterosexual marriage, and family life as ordained by God in Genesis, with one man and one woman and their children (adoptions included) being the standard. Same sex and multiple marriage partners are nowhere ordained by God, although some scriptures makes reference to one man having more than one wife, but this was of human origin.



We will uphold the sanctity of human life, which is sacred to God and humanity and will preserve it whenever and however naturally possible. This is to include the non-acceptance of abortion and euthanasia as morally acceptable, and the non-use of birth-control measures which are non-contraceptive (before conception) in nature.



We will be faithful stewards of time, money, and possessions, body, mind, and spirit, knowing that our souls are ultimately accountable to God.



We will abstain from the appearance of evil, including, but not limited to, alcohol, tobacco, addictive drugs, gambling, pornography, the occult or anything else that could ensnare the body or spirit.



Having accepted Yeshua, the Christ as Sovereign and Savior, and desiring to join in the fellowship of God’s earthly Church as a Go Fish Servant and Minister, We now by God's grace enter into a covenant of faith and fellowship with Go Fish Ministries, (Gifts of Faith Inspiring Serving Hands). We believe and will seek to live by the truths of the Word of God as expressed in the Go Fish Articles of Faith. We will be faithful to the purposes of Go Fish Ministries, endeavoring to share the Gospel of Yeshua, the Christ, and in the name of Yeshua, comfort victims of violence and care for others in need. We will be actively involved, as able, in the life, work, worship and witness of the ministry, giving as large a portion of income as possible to support its ministries, whether it be out of sacrifice (the widow’s mite) or abundance (the tithe and gifts). We will be true to the principles and practices of Go Fish Ministries, loyal to its leaders as long as they are clearly under the direction of God, and will show the spirit of faith and fellowship to the ministry, whether in times of acceptance or persecution. We now enter into this covenant of faith and fellowship of our own free will, convinced that the love of Yeshua, who died and now lives to give all who believe eternal security, requires the devotion of our lives and persons to the service of Yeshua; and therefore do here declare our full conviction, by God's help, to be true Servants of Go Fish Ministries.
